Let's break down what truly happens to your wallet.\n\n## The Immediate Financial Fallout\n\n### Lost Deposits and Cancellation Fees\nWhen you book auto transport, most companies require a deposit. If you need to cancel because the driver didn't show up, you might lose that deposit. This depends on the cancellation policy. Many companies have 7-10 day cancellation policies. We aim to prevent these headaches.\n\n### Rental Car Expenses: The Silent Budget Killer\nWhen your car isn't picked up as scheduled, you're suddenly without reliable transportation. Rental cars aren't cheap. Maybe you're relocating to Florida. Perhaps you're shipping a car from Houston to Los Angeles. Either way, you need to get around.\n\n Economy rental: $40-$80 per day.\n Insurance add-ons: $15-$30 per day.\n Fuel costs: This is an additional out-of-pocket expense.\n Insurance waivers: Expect extra daily charges.\n\nOne-week delay impact: That's $280-$840+ out of your pocket. All this happens before your car even moves. This can quickly derail your budget for cross-country car transport from coast to coast.\n\n## The Domino Effect on Your Entire Move\n\n### Missed Connection Costs\nYour car's arrival is often timed with other logistics. When that schedule gets disrupted, things go south quickly.\n\n Flight change fees: $200-$500 per ticket. This adds up fast for families or if you need multi-car transport.\n Extended storage fees: If your vehicle is waiting somewhere, storage facilities charge daily rates. These can range from $50-$150 per day depending on the location. This is especially true for shipping a non-running vehicle. An experienced car shipping broker you can trust is crucial.\n\n## Why No-Shows Happen in Auto Transport\n\n### Carrier-Side Issues\nCarriers face tough challenges. These can cause missed pickups.\n\n Mechanical breakdowns: Trucks are complex machines. An open car carrier transport or an enclosed auto transport for luxury cars can break down. It's a fact of life on the road.\n Weather delays: Blizzards, hurricanes, and wildfires stop traffic. If you're using nationwide vehicle shipping door to door, weather is a real factor. This impacts how long does car shipping take cross country.\n Driver availability: Drivers can get sick. They might exceed their hours of service limits. There's a shortage of drivers.
